About The Position

We are seeking a Lead Product Manager to define and own the future of e-commerce for The Knot Worldwide. This is a high-impact, high-visibility role focused on the cart and payments platform that powers our entire business. You will be the single-threaded owner responsible for the multi-year strategy, product performance, and user experience of a platform that processes millions of transactions across complex, mixed-cart scenarios. We're looking for a product-led entrepreneur who thrives at the intersection of large-scale retail technology and complex financial systems. You will report to the Senior Director of Product and lead a dedicated squad of exceptional design, data, and engineering partners with deep retail expertise. If you are obsessed with solving complex, high-scale problems and are passionate about making one of life's biggest moments joyful (and seamless), this is your opportunity.

Requirements

  • 7+ years in product management, with a track record of driving complex, high-impact initiatives
  • Deep expertise in e-commerce with a focus on cart, checkout, and payment systems.
  • A well-developed point of view on how to best serve users in cash gifting scenarios.
  • The ability to set strategic direction and help ideate and launch new products and experiences
  • The ability to refer to quantitative and qualitative data in making product decisions and have experience with analytics and research tools + methods and comfort with analytical tools
  • A track record of creating quality consumer experiences that solve real user needs and drive business growth
  • The skills to communicate clearly and collaborate effectively with your partners and executives
  • Keen aesthetics and empathy, and a user-centered mentality
  • A track record of being a strong partner for engineers, empathetic to their unique needs, and you believe there's such a thing as tech debt

Responsibilities

  • Drive outcome-focused execution - what matters most is how the product impacts our customers and our business.
  • Define the strategic vision and multi-year roadmap for the TKWW checkout and cart experience, creating a seamless, trustworthy, and high-converting funnel for both couples and their guests.
  • Own the product lifecycle for our universal cart, optimizing for complex, mixed-cart scenarios (e.g., third-party registry items, cash funds, honeymoon contributions, and physical products).
  • Champion a world-class guest experience, deeply understanding the user psychology of "gifting" to reduce friction, build trust, and drive measurable improvements.
  • Partner with design and user research to prototype, test, and launch new checkout experiences.
  • Lead the company's core payments strategy, managing the full stack from payment processing and gateway relationships to fraud prevention and cost optimization.
  • Drive the roadmap for payment method expansion, evaluating and integrating digital wallets (Apple Pay, Google Pay), Buy Now Pay Later (BNPL) solutions.
  • Own the key business metrics for payments and implement strategies to improve them continuously.
  • Serve as the principal product liaison with Finance, Legal, and Security to ensure ironclad compliance.
  • Act as the company's foremost subject matter expert for all e-commerce transactions, payments, and compliance, guiding executive stakeholders and engineering architects on technical and strategic decisions.
  • Lead and mentor a pod of engineers and analysts, fostering a culture of data-driven decision-making, rapid experimentation, and customer obsession.
  • Collaborate with product leaders to ensure cohesion between your products and the overall product experience on The Knot
